有机污染物1,4-二氯苯的研究进展
Research Progress on Organic Pollutant 1,4-Dichlorobenzene

Abstract
1,4-dichlorobenzene(P-DCB)is a typical volatile organic pollutant,characterized by its high volatility and recalcitrance to degradation.It can be transported through the atmosphere,accumulate in the food chain,and pose significant risks to human health and ecological systems.P-DCB has been widely utilized in various industrial sectors as a crucial intermediate in the chlor-alkali industry,as well as in the production of dyes,fragrances,pharmaceuticals,and pesticides.It also serves functions in sterilization,disinfection,and deodorization.However,its high volatility and persistence result in bioaccumulation within living organisms,leading to increased concentrations in specific environments.Agricultural practices also involve the application of P-DCB,which can enter the human body directly or indirectly,thereby impacting human health.As awareness of its detrimental effects on the ecological environment has grown,addressing pollution caused by organochlorine pesticides,particularly P-DCB,has emerged as a critical issue requiring urgent attention.This paper reviews the current status and advancements in research on P-DCB,focusing on analytical methods,synthesis,environmental impacts,agricultural applications,and degradation process.关键词
